Output 521b25e379327df38b5d6fe2e5d44c821c195bdb00040368a016161fb04e78e6:0

value
75182118
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ad71d7f39260213879a319b409277f861ca38a6a OP_EQUAL
address
3HW7CihCHYbD1CcoEerDS5ArZETzQQgGJF
transaction
521b25e379327df38b5d6fe2e5d44c821c195bdb00040368a016161fb04e78e6
spent
true